About The Position

Provides direct staff support for an Electronic Health Records (EHR) system based on MS SQL Server. Provides Technical Support on Client Portal functions for Staff and Staff relayed client issues. Diagnoses issues with and/or enhances the Health records system – primarily via the alteration or construction of MS SQL Stored Procedures. Construction of SQL Server Reporting System components (SSRS RDLS). Fundamentally understands SQL – including the ability to construct complex queries that may involve the use of CTEs, temporary working tables, and higher-level SQL Server SQL extensions. Develops and maintains SQL database reports and customized Business Intelligence Reports utilizing SQL databases and Power BI to transform raw data into meaningful, visual dashboards and reports for Executive Leadership, Division Directors, Program Administrators, and Quality Assurance. Automates processes using MS SQL Reporting Services when possible. Interacts with end users to establish and clarify reporting requirements and develops SQL reports to specifications. Troubleshoots, diagnoses, and resolves database performance issues. Manages deployment of security patches, hotfixes, and software updates to SQL servers/databases – both internally managed Databases and those managed by the Health Records system vendor. Works closely with the MIS team supporting all Center systems and maintenance activities. Works directly with vendors where required on escalated issues or enhancements. Creates and maintains documentation of SQL and Power BI reporting. Routinely works on integration of products between current applications and new applications as they are implemented utilizing various APIs.

Requirements

  • Associate level College Degree in Information Technology or higher level degree preferred.
  • Experience such as certifications or equivalent work experience with MS-SQL (2014 or higher) Server and relational database applications required.
  • Two (2) years of work experience in SQL development and reporting required.
  • Fundamentally understands SQL – including the ability to construct complex queries that may involve the use of CTEs, temporary working tables, and higher-level SQL Server SQL extensions.

Nice To Haves

  • A minimum of 2 years of experience with SmartCare from Streamline Health (EHR) performing administrative/support functions preferred.
  • 1 or more years of experience with Microsoft Power BI preferred.
